Abstract

We present a computationally efficient algorithm which combines the finite element method with Pade approximation. The combination is used to solve the problem of transverse magnetic and transverse electric scattering from homogeneous lossy dielectric cylinders over a continuous range of the complex permittivity variable by requiring the finite element solution only at a single complex permittivity value. The proposed method is based on (1) assuming a power series expansion for the unknown solution vector, the excitation vector, and the system matrix, (2) substituting this into the system matrix equation, and (3) finding the recursion relation for the solution vectors.
